Transaction 66303bb79e6b122540763e9778296d85e8d3d2b1c42eb761970ac250a4db7e5a
1 Input
1 Output
-
66303bb79e6b122540763e9778296d85e8d3d2b1c42eb761970ac250a4db7e5a:0
- value
- 714841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 617af6719c0d3cbf09e19d68e5015598bf634324 OP_EQUAL
- address
- 3AaSmkJjdeMPZgnWsy36XfdcoHpV3PZg6e